Web19 dec. 2024 · FAR 35.017-8 states that the NSF will maintain a master federal government list of FFRDCs. This list was formally established in 1967 and is the definitive list of … Web1 dec. 2024 · NSF has the responsibility of maintaining a master list of FFRDCs across the federal government. According to NSF and as shown in Appendix A, 26 of the 42 current FFRDCs are R&D laboratories, 10 are study and analysis centers, and 6 are system engineering and integration centers. The National Center for Science and Engineering Statistics (NCSES) is one of the thirteen principal statistical agencies of the United States and is tasked with providing objective data on the status of the science and engineering enterprise in the U.S. and other countries.
